2. What does "basement not renovated" typically mean for a home of this era?
In a 1969 4-level split, this usually indicates the lower levels retain their original finishes and layout. Buyers should budget for potential updates to flooring, lighting, and possibly bathrooms or kitchens in those spaces. It also represents an opportunity to customize the space to modern needs.

3. Is the living space distributed well across the four levels?
The 4-level split design often creates smaller, defined areas on each level rather than large, open floors. This can be ideal for separating living and sleeping zones or creating a dedicated rec room space, but may not suit those preferring an open-concept main floor.
